Demi Rose Radiates Elegance and Glamour at the Star-Studded Soho After Dark Launch in London
Demi Rose Radiates Elegance and Glamour at the Star-Studded Soho After Dark Launch in London
Demi Rose Radiates Elegance and Glamour at the Star-Studded Soho After Dark Launch in London